Как загрузить pdf в базу данных MySQL и выполнить поиск по метаданным? - PullRequest
0 голосов
/ 14 сентября 2018

Я пишу код для веб-приложения, в котором есть возможность загрузки файлов PDF.Я должен хранить метаданные файла pdf в базе данных MySQL, потому что позже некоторые из этих метаданных, такие как автор или год, будут критериями поиска.Какой самый простой способ сделать что-то подобное?

1 Ответ

0 голосов
/ 14 сентября 2018

Простой способ - сохранить PDF-файл в хранилище BLOB-объектов (например, AWS S3 или GCS). Эти хранилища вернут уникальный идентификатор хранимого объекта. В MySql сохраните все необходимые метаданные, а также ссылку на сохраненный объект для последующего извлечения.

Если вы не хотите добавлять дополнительное хранилище, сериализуйте PDF-файл в байты и сохраните его непосредственно в строке в столбце.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...